The Infrastructure Behind OpenAI $110 Billion Investment

OpenAI $110 Billion Investment is largely about infrastructure rather than consumer products.

Most people associate artificial intelligence with chatbots and AI assistants.

However, the real challenge behind AI progress is computing power.

Training large AI models requires enormous clusters of specialized hardware.

Thousands of high-performance GPUs must operate simultaneously to process massive datasets.

Each new generation of models demands significantly more compute capacity than the previous one.

Electricity consumption alone becomes a serious engineering problem at this scale.

Building AI infrastructure therefore resembles building power plants or telecommunications networks.

Massive data centers must be designed to support continuous training and deployment of AI models.

These facilities require advanced cooling systems, reliable energy supply, and specialized networking architecture.

The OpenAI $110 Billion Investment enables that level of expansion.

Without infrastructure, AI progress slows dramatically.

With infrastructure, innovation accelerates.

Long-Term Effects Of OpenAI $110 Billion Investment

OpenAI $110 Billion Investment may mark a turning point in how artificial intelligence develops globally.

Technology revolutions often accelerate rapidly once infrastructure investment begins.

The internet followed a similar pattern during its expansion phase.

Cloud computing experienced the same shift when large-scale data centers became widespread.

Artificial intelligence may now be entering its own infrastructure expansion cycle.

Better computing capacity leads to stronger AI models.

Stronger models lead to broader adoption across industries.

Broader adoption leads to entirely new business opportunities and economic models.

That cycle can compound quickly once momentum begins.

The OpenAI $110 Billion Investment therefore represents more than a financial milestone.

It reflects a belief that AI will become one of the most important technologies of this century.

Frequently Asked Questions About OpenAI $110 Billion Investment

  1. What is the OpenAI $110 Billion Investment?
    The OpenAI $110 Billion Investment refers to a massive funding round aimed at expanding AI infrastructure, computing capacity, and global deployment of artificial intelligence systems.

  2. Why is the OpenAI $110 Billion Investment important?
    It signals strong confidence from major technology companies that artificial intelligence will become a foundational layer of future industries.

  3. Who invested in the OpenAI $110 Billion Investment?
    Major investors reportedly include Amazon, Nvidia, SoftBank, and other partners supporting the development of large-scale AI infrastructure.
